Non-stick coating degradation and microparticle release
The unspecified non-stick coating on the cooking basket may shed microparticles over time, especially if scratched or exposed to high heat. Inhaling or ingesting these particles is a documented concern in air-fryer use, but frequency and severity depend entirely on the coating material, which Cosori does not disclose.
Thermal fume release from non-stick coating
If the coating is Teflon-type coating-based (common in non-stick cookware), overheating beyond manufacturer limits can trigger release of fluorinated gases and particulates (polymer fume fever). Cosori does not specify temperature limits or coating type, leaving users to rely on general guidance.
Bacterial growth in heating element or crevices
Air fryers accumulate food residue and grease in crevices and on heating elements. If not cleaned regularly, bacteria and mold can grow in these areas, posing a hygiene rather than chemical hazard. This applies broadly to the product category but is user-dependent.
Manufacturing emissions (off-gassing on first use)
New air fryers may release volatile organic compounds (VOCs) from the non-stick coating, insulation, or adhesives during initial heating. This is typically temporary and resolves after a few preheating cycles but can trigger respiratory irritation in sensitive individuals; ventilate during first use.

The full breakdown
What it's made of and why it matters
The Cosori Premium II Plus has a stainless steel exterior housing, which is chemically inert and does not leach into food. The cooking basket features a non-stick coating of unknown composition; Cosori does not publicly specify whether this is Teflon-type coating-based (Teflon-type), ceramic, or another polymer. Non-stick coatings can shed microparticles or release fumes if overheated or damaged, making the lack of transparency a material concern for this product.
The brand's record and disclosure
Cosori maintains a corporate website emphasizing product design and user reviews but does not publish material safety data sheets, coating specifications, or PFAS-related statements on widely available channels. The brand has not pursued third-party certifications (such as Greenguard or similar) to validate air-fryer safety claims. This silence on chemical composition is notable in a product category where non-stick coatings are the primary surface contact point with food.
How it compares in its category
Air fryers typically rely on non-stick coatings to function; most major brands (Instant Pot, Ninja, Philips) similarly do not disclose coating chemistry on product pages, though some have committed to phasing Teflon-type coating in response to consumer pressure. The Cosori Premium II Plus is mid-range in price and popularity but offers no material advantage in transparency compared to competitors. Ceramic-coated alternatives exist but are rarer and often more expensive in this category.
If you buy it
Use the air fryer at manufacturer-specified temperatures (typically under 400F for most models); Teflon-type coating coatings degrade and release fumes above 500F. Inspect the cooking basket regularly for scratches, peeling, or discoloration, which indicate coating breakdown; replace if visible damage occurs. Hand-wash the basket gently to avoid abrasion; avoid metal utensils. If you detect any odor during preheating or cooking, stop use immediately and ventilate the kitchen.
